## About

Since 1989, Trent Valley Archives has been a vital resource for local history and family research, preserving over 1000 cubic feet of documents, photographs, and newspapers from the Trent Valley region. Located on Carnegie Avenue, they offer engaging historical tours, workshops, and a wealth of archival materials for anyone curious about Peterborough's past.
